Silversmithing has a rich history, tracing back over 5,000 years to ancient civilisations such as Egypt and Mesopotamia, where skilled artisans shaped silver into intricate jewellery and decorative objects. Over the centuries, techniques evolved across cultures, from the fine detailing of ancient Rome to the elaborate silverwork of the European Renaissance. Today, silversmithing blends tradition with modern creativity, allowing artisans to produce both classic and contemporary pieces.

Under the guidance of experienced silversmiths, you will learn to craft a custom-fit silver bangle, tailored precisely to your wrist. Using traditional silversmithing techniques, you will shape, hammer and polish your piece to bring it to life. You will also explore the possibilities of silver clay — a highly versatile material that becomes 99.9% pure silver once fired. Silver clay can be used to add decorative elements to your bangle, or to create standalone pieces such as earrings, charms or a necklace pendant.

You will also learn how to make custom moulds, capturing textures from nature or favourite pieces of costume jewellery. You are welcome to bring along leaves, shells or other small objects that inspire you, which can be used to create distinctive silver impressions.
